대회/코드포스
#721 div2 5/23 virtual
xkdlaldfjtnl
2021. 5. 23. 12:29
https://codeforces.com/contest/1527
Dashboard - Codeforces Round #721 (Div. 2) - Codeforces
codeforces.com
A And Then There Were K
n에서 k까지 &연산을 한 뒤에 0이 되는 최대의 k를 구하기
&연산은 2^m꼴 끼리 연산을 하는 것이므로 처음으로 n보다 작은 2^m-1 을 출력하면 된다.
B1 Palindrome Game (easy version)
팰린드롬 문자열에서 시작하므로 Alice는 무조건 처음에 cost를 소비할 수 밖에 없다.
그렇다면 이제 Bob이 무조건 이기는 것 같은데 Alice가 이기는 한 가지 경우가 있다. 문자열의 크기가 홀수이면서, 그 문자열의 중간 문자가 0이고, 또 0의 갯수가 1보다 클때 이긴다. 이때가 아니면 모두 Bob 승리